Community Medical Services of Belgrade is a Medical Clinic in Belgrade, MT. The clinic provides medication‑assisted treatment, counseling, peer‑to‑peer support and psychiatry services for individuals struggling with opioid use disorder, including heroin and fentanyl addiction. It offers same‑day intakes and welcomes walk‑ins, aiming to help patients begin recovery quickly. With a 4.5‑star rating based on 22 reviews, the clinic serves residents of Belgrade and surrounding areas.
The Belgrade location takes a holistic approach, combining the latest medications for opioid use disorder with individualized counseling and support plans. Patients receive coordinated care that may include treatment for co‑occurring mental‑health conditions such as anxiety, depression, PTSD, ADHD and bipolar disorder.
